And the week just keeps getting better...well no, not really

Turns out that Microsoft don' know nuthin about being able to downgrade your operating system.

Toshiba does -- but if you machine turns out to have Windows 8 standard on it, and not Windows 8 Pro, you're not allowed to downgrade your machine. You must pay for the upgrade first, or you must pay for Windows 7. Why was this "guarantee" part of the software agreement I had to click through to originally boot the machine? Why do I not have the WIN 8 Pro I thought I bought?

Mysteries of the universe.

There are 45 drivers listed for the S955 laptop. Nowhere do I see that they will work with WIN 7 on this machine.

I'm guessing that I continue to be #$%^#@ over on this purchase.

Oh -- the nice young woman at Costco Concierge says that the keys wearing off is a manufacturer's defect, and I can send my machine back into have the keyboard replaced.

Yeah -- like I'm going to risk having a computer that works, however poorly, re-enter the factory and have the keys pried off because of the key alphanumerics wearing off in four months? And will we do this again in another four months?

I got news for them -- I'm getting glow in the dark keyboard stickers. WIN!
